In this …Jun 25, 2023 · A look at the data stats of polycarbonate confirms the impressive strength of polycarbonate 3D printer filament. PC has a specific gravity of 1.18 g/cm³. This density makes it comparable to PMMA and PLA and about one-fifth denser than ABS. It has a Rockwell hardness of R 121, making it harder than PMMA, ABS and PLA.

Today, let’s explore the world of elegance and innovation with the Silk PLA+ Gun Metal Gray 1.75mm filament by FilaCube. Nylon prints are more of a challenge due to its hygroscopic properties. Even short-term exposure to high humidity can result in “wet” filament which, when printed, can lead to inconsistency in dimensional accuracy and part strength. Due to this property, it is critical to store the nylon filament in a dry place. Some FDM 3D printers are enclosed so …Either way, it's somewhere to start. Good luck! Most plastic stocks, like the ...The Creality Ender 3 V2 is perhaps the best 3D printer for guns and related parts because it’s got a decently-large print bed that will allow you to print handgun … zyrtec and mucinex dm together PETG is about as strong as PLA or PLA+, but it is less stiff. This makes it significantly more elastic (stretchable) and more impact tolerant. The problem is that being less stiff means that things are more apt to deform under load. One of the more obvious places this can happen is with pin holes. The pin diameter is almost never designed for a ... other sites like rubmaps If so, pros and cons?
